An automatic book scanner is a great option when you have large volumes of bound books to scan. For example, a national library going into mass digitization would be the perfect place to implement automatic scanning of bound books and documents.

After first constructing a book scanner from scrap, Daniel has since created a portable, machined, sophisticated book scanner that is still a do-it-yourself project. It uses digital cameras and a book cradle to allow one to generate images that software can combine into a PDF of a book. The specifications and instructions are freely available.

As the name suggests, it is a device converting physical books and printed material into digital media such as images, electronic text, or electronic books (e-books). Technology-wise, book scanners can be as simple as a cardboard box rig, a camera on a tripod, and your hand as the controller. Or they can have multiple moving parts with computer-controlled capture and high-resolution cameras. Some even have a robotic arm, carefully turning the pages of the book as it is being scanned.


Modern book scanners are usually built around five basic elements, but high-end models can even feature additional components, such as air-sucking technology or infrared camera installations which allow detection and automatic adjustment of the three-dimensional shape of the page.


Though some scanners can be used with ambient room lighting, a dedicated light source is crucial for capturing high-quality images. Furthermore, the lights need to be strong and even, and ideally positioned to minimise glare and reflections. Most book scanners have light sources on either side of the camera, mounted on a frame or physical support for an evenly spread illumination.


Depending on the model, a book scanner usually features one or two cameras. The simpler version is the single camera book scanner, manually operated but easy to use. The book lies open on flat support while an overhead camera captures images of the pages. However, depending on the book size, corrective software needs to be used to cancel the resulting image distortion and recreate the original image of the page. More advanced book scanner models include a pair of cameras. Each camera must be mounted securely and aligned to point directly at the centre of the page it is scanning. Two cameras can capture both pages at the same time, one for each open page, and in combination with a V-shaped book support the resulting captured images require almost no software correction.


The book lies at the centre of any book scanner. It is alternately pressed against the platen for scanning and then pulled away so that the page can be flipped, a process that is being fully automated in the more advanced book scanner models. If you are scanning a rare edition, however, manual operations are still mandatory to avoid any damage to the book.


At the bottom side of the book scanner lies the cradle, which supports the back and spine of the book being digitised. While any contact with a book will cause wear and tear, a V-shaped cradle can minimise the wear that scanning can cause.
